Job Description:
We are seeking a highly skilled Business Systems Analyst (BSA) with strong product management experience-ideally gained in a high-scale, customer-obsessed organization such as Amazon, Shopify, Meta, or other digital-first enterprises. This role blends business analysis, product thinking, and technical understanding. The ideal candidate brings a grounded IT background, excels at bridging business needs with technology solutions, and thrives in fast-paced, ambiguous environments.
You will act as a connector across business, product, and engineering teams-translating complex requirements into clear user stories, refining problem statements, and ensuring delivery outcomes meet customer and stakeholder expectations. You will work closely with Product Managers, Architects, Engineers, UX Designers, QA, and Operations teams to drive clarity, shape roadmaps, and support execution.
Key Responsibilities
Product & Business Analysis
• Partner closely with Product Managers to define product requirements, scope features, and refine business cases.
• Break down complex workflows into clear user stories, acceptance criteria, and solution documentation.
• Conduct business process analysis, gap analysis, and impact assessments across systems and teams.
• Help articulate the "why" behind the product-ensuring features are aligned to customer value, operational realities, and strategic priorities.
• Participate in product roadmap discussions, backlog prioritization, and release planning.
Cross-Functional Collaboration
• Serve as a liaison across product, engineering, operations, and business stakeholders.
• Coordinate requirement walkthroughs, grooming sessions, and design discussions with cross-functional teams.
• Translate business needs into technical concepts for engineering teams, and technical constraints into business language for stakeholders.
• Support change management efforts and help business units prepare for new features or system updates.
Technical & Systems Understanding
• Leverage an IT background to evaluate system dependencies, APIs, integrations, and data flows.
• Work with Solution Architects / Engineering to ensure system designs meet functional and non-functional requirements.
• Review technical documentation, sequence diagrams, and workflows to validate alignment with requirements.
• Support testing phases (UAT, regression, integration) by preparing test scenarios and validating outcomes against acceptance criteria.
Customer Focus & Product Thinking
• Apply a strong customer-obsession mindset (Amazon-style) to ensure solutions solve real customer problems.
• Use data-driven decision-making to validate problem statements, measure success, and inform product improvements.
• Advocate for usability, simplicity, and operational excellence in all solutions.
